Inetha Hutchinson, nee Davis
Posted By Hitzeman Funeral Home On July 31, 2004 @ 7:39 pm In Obituary | No Comments
Inetha Hutchinson, nee Davis, age 64, of Broadview formerly of Henderson, TN. Beloved wife of the late John Phillip Hutchinson: fond mother of Ta’Mar (Scott) Harding: dear grandmother of Damien (Yolanda) Roberts, Candace (Adam) Montgomery, Michael Harding and Scott P. Harding: great-grandmother of Darian Harding, Tyler Montgomery and Alexie Roberts: sister of Clara Bell Jones, Margie (Charles) Hunter, Frances (Earl) Johnson, Shirley (Simon) Hutchinson and John Davis. Visitation Friday, July 30, 2004, 5 PM to 9 PM and Saturday, July 31, 2004, 10:30 AM to time of Service 11 AM at Hitzeman Funeral Home, Ltd., 9445 W. 31st Street, Brookfield. Interment Private. Worked at the African American Culture Center, her poetry helped inspire Dr. Martin Luther Kings’ Speech “I Have a Dream,” member of the International Hostess Club, Published chef, active poet, Nurse’s Aide at the Garfield Park Hospital Newborn Unit, Girl Scout Leader, Foster Parent to many, and was an avid gardener.
